Abstract
The utility model relates to a medical care appliance, in particular to a care bed. The care bed comprises a bedstead and a bed board, wherein the bed board comprises a haunch bed board, a back bed board flapping up and down, as well as a left thigh bed board and a right thigh bed board flapping up and down, wherein, the haunch bed board is arranged the middle part of the bedstead, the back bed board flapping up and down is arranged at one end of the haunch bed board, and the left thigh bed board and the right thigh bed board flapping up and down are arranged at the other end of the haunch bed board, and the left thigh bed board and the right thigh bed board are respectively hinged with a left shank bed board and a right shank bed board. The care bed can realize the stooping, getting up, and lying down of any angles within a range of 0 DEG to 70 DEG, and realize the leg lifting and leg stretching of any angles in within a range of 0 DEG to 40 DEG, thereby relieving the bowels in a comfortable sitting position.
Description
Technical field
This utility model relates to the medical treatment and nursing apparatus, particularly a kind of nursing bed.
Background technology
Nursing bed is hospital or home care, looks after one of necessaries of sickbed patients, the patient can be bent over easily, stand up, lift lower limb, stretches one's legs and defecation.Existing nursing bed adopts screw-nut body or pinion and rack transmission more, crank handle drives, rotary electric machine drives or the hydraulic drive mode method, hand-rail type drives workload that has increased the nursing staff and the communication problem that has patient and nursing staff, there is complex structure in the kind of drive of screw-nut body or pinion and rack, noise is big, impact endurance test shock is big, lubricated maintenance is difficult, the defective of power attenuation, and there is the higher defective of cost in hydraulic drive mode.
The utility model content
This utility model purpose provides a kind of easy to use, comfortable nursing bed.
This utility model adopts technical scheme: a kind of nursing bed, comprise bedstead, bed board, bed board comprises the buttocks bed board that is arranged at the bedstead middle part, be arranged at the back bed board that buttocks bed board one end can swing up and down, be arranged at left thigh bed board, right thigh bed board that the buttocks bed board other end can swing up and down, the hinged left leg bed board of difference, right leg bed board on left thigh bed board, right thigh bed board.
Back bed board amplitude of fluctuation is at ° angle, 0 °≤a≤70, and left thigh bed board, right thigh bed board amplitude of fluctuation are at ° angle, 0 °≤β≤40, and wherein a is back bed board and horizontal angle, and β is left thigh bed board or right thigh bed board and horizontal angle.
The back linear electric motors that are installed in bedstead are by the bed board swing of back bed board lever control back; Left thigh bed board, left leg bed board, the left thigh bed board lever that is connected with the left thigh bed board, the left leg bed board lever that is connected with the left leg bed board and the turnbuckle that connects between left thigh bed board lever and the left leg bed board lever form linkage, and the left lower limb linear electric motors that are installed in bedstead are by the swing of left thigh bed board lever control left thigh bed board; Right thigh bed board, right leg bed board, the right thigh bed board lever that is connected with the right thigh bed board, the right leg bed board lever that is connected with the right leg bed board and the turnbuckle that connects between right thigh bed board lever and the right leg bed board lever form another linkage, and the right lower limb linear electric motors that are installed in bedstead are by the swing of right thigh bed board lever control right thigh bed board; Two linkage structures are identical, left-right symmetric.
The buttocks bed board that is arranged at the bedstead middle part is divided into two, and a part is a fixing head, and another part is removable portable plate.
Back, left lower limb, shared battery, control box, the remote controller of right lower limb linear electric motors configuration.
This utility model directly drives back bed board lever by linear electric motors and the back bed board is realized swing at any angle in 0~70 ° of scope, finishes the action of bending over, stand up.Directly drive thigh bed board lever and thigh bed board by linear electric motors and realize the swing at any angle in 0~40 ° of scope of left and right foot respectively, finish and lift lower limb, the action of stretching one's legs.Move the removable portable plate of buttocks bed board by nursing staff or patient and can carry out defecation.Configuration CB common battery, control box, remote controller, the patient uses a teleswitch and regulates the optimum range of bending over, stand up, lifting lower limb, stretch one's legs, and can meet an urgent need under power down mode and use more than 2 hours.
This utility model is easy to use, comfortable; Simple in structure, processing request is low, is easy to make, install; Consumable accessorys such as drive system gearless, tooth bar or leading screw, it is easy to maintenance that noise is low and lubricated etc.; Linear electric motors provide power, are easy to control, and need not be equipped with air feed, liquid-supplying system in addition, are convenient to promote.

The specific embodiment
When patient need bend over, stands up and lie down, be installed in back linear electric motors on the head of a bed crossbeam by nursing staff or the control of patient's remote controller, its telescopic shaft is connected with back bed board lever, telescopic shaft stretches and directly drives the back bed board, realizes the action of bending at any angle, standing up and lying down in 0~70 ° of scope.
When patient's left foot need lift lower limb, when stretching one's legs, be installed in left lower limb linear electric motors on the tailstock crossbeam by nursing staff or the control of patient's remote controller, its telescopic shaft is connected with left thigh bed board lever, directly drive the left thigh bed board, realize the action of lifting lower limb at any angle, stretching one's legs in 0~40 ° of scope.
When patient's right crus of diaphragm need lift lower limb, when stretching one's legs, be installed in right lower limb linear electric motors on the tailstock crossbeam by nursing staff or the control of patient's remote controller, its telescopic shaft is connected with right thigh bed board lever, directly drive the right thigh bed board, realize the action of lifting lower limb at any angle, stretching one's legs in 0~40 ° of scope.
When patient needs large and small just the time, degree by nursing staff or the control of patient's remote controller are bent over, stand up, lifted lower limb, stretch one's legs is implemented on this nursing bed by nursing staff or the removable portable plate of patient's manual operation shifted laterally buttocks bed board and solves large and small problem just with the most comfortable sitting posture.
When patient need lift lower limb, when stretching one's legs, regulate turnbuckle by the nursing staff and can adjust to reach the degree of the most comfortable the angle of shank and thigh.
